Description
A moist and flavorful banana cake slice perfect for a delightful dessert or snack. This recipe features ripe bananas, a tender crumb, and a hint of vanilla for a classic taste.
Ingredients
1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on baking soda
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
3/4 cup granulated sugar
2 large eggs
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
3 ripe bananas, mashed
1/4 cup sour cream
1/2 cup chopped walnuts
Instructions
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and flour an 8-inch square baking pan.
In a medium b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, baking soda, and salt. Set aside.
In a large bowl, cream the softened unsalted butter and granulated sugar together until light and fluffy.
Beat in the eggs one at a time, then stir in the vanilla extract.
Mix in the mashed ripe bananas and sour cream until well combined.
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, mixing just until incorporated.
Fold in the chopped walnuts gently.
Pour the batter into the prepared baking pan and spread evenly.
Bake in the preheated oven for 35 to 40 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
Remove from oven and allow the cake to cool in the pan for 10 minutes.
Turn the cake out onto a wire rack and cool completely before slicing into 8 equal pieces.
Serve each banana cake slice plain or with a dusting of powdered sugar or a dollop of whipped cream if desired.
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 40 minutes
